Abstract
853,884. Unattended repeaters. GENERAL ELECTRIC CO. Ltd., and INGRAM, D. G. W. Feb. 6, 1959 [Feb. 18, 1958], No. 5204/58. Class 40 (4). The gain of a negative feed-back amplifier at a repeater station is monitored at a terminal station by having a signal characteristic of the repeater and injecting it into the amplifier in such a way that the transmitted amplitude of the characteristic signal increases as the gain of the amplifier falls and increases more rapidly than the gain falls. The invention may be applied to a frequency or time-division multiplex system using radio or cable links. A repeater may have an amplifier, as shown in Fig. 1, comprising three stages of grounded emitter transistors the multiplex path being over the terminals 30, 31 to 32, 33 and a local oscillator (not shown), producing a characteristic frequency of a given amplitude which when connected across terminals 50, 52 in the output circuit produces an output across the terminals 32, 33 of an amplitude comparable with that of the multiplex signals. The frequencies of the characteristic signals are chosen to lie below or above those used for the multiplex transmission. Reduction of gain produced by deterioration of components causes the amplitude of the characteristic frequency appearing at terminals 32, 33 to increase by virtue of the feed-back path which includes resistor 45 and capacitor 48. Separate amplifiers may be used in the go and return paths in which case the same characteristic frequency may be injected into both amplifiers at each repeater station and each terminal station receives gain monitoring signals relating to the incoming path only. If a common amplifier is used for both directions of transmission only one terminal station receives the signals. All characteristic signal frequencies may be filtered out of the transmission path at a terminal station and by mixing with the output of a variable oscillator each frequency in turn may be changed to a fixed frequency which is filtered, rectified, and used to indicate the gain of its amplifier.
